Banish Hearing Aid Dome Itch - Dr. Goldberg ENT Tricks
Experiencing persistent discomfort from your hearing aid domes? You're not alone! Many individuals encounter this common problem. Thankfully, Dr. Goldberg ENT is here to offer some valuable advice to alleviate the itch and keep your ears satisfied. First, ensure you're using the appropriate size of dome for your hearing aid. A poorly fitting can cause friction and irritation. Secondly, regularly sanitize your domes with a soft cloth or the proper cleaning solution from your hearing aid manufacturer. Foster a habit of replacing your domes daily to prevent buildup that can cause itching.
- Moreover, avoid using harsh soaps or agents on your domes, as they can aggravate the ear canal.
- Explore switching to hypoallergenic domes if you have sensitive skin.
- Last but not least, if the itching persists or is accompanied by other symptoms such as pain, redness, or discharge, see your ENT doctor immediately.
Hearing Aid Discomfort: A Guide to Stopping Ear Itch
Dealing with an itchy ear after you wear your hearing aids can be truly frustrating. {Thankfully|Fortunately, there are simple steps you can take to minimize this discomfort. Dr. Goldberg, a leading audiologist, recommends starting with choosing the right size of dome for your hearing aids. An ill-fitting tip can trap humidity against your ear canal, creating an itchy situation.
Regularly cleaning your hearing aids and domes is essential as well. Dust can build up in the dome, causing an itchy reaction. Dr. Goldberg also suggests avoiding inserting your fingers into your ear canals, as this can transmit bacteria and worsen the itching.
- Think about using a hearing aid liner to create an extra barrier between your ear canal and the insert.
- Talk with your audiologist if you experience persistent itching or other ear discomfort.
- Remember that good hygiene practices are essential for maintaining comfortable hearing aid use.
